FC Quiles (Felipe Castro Quiles) is an international entrepreneur, AI strategist, philosopher of technology, and global speaker whose work centers on a single, urgent question: whose assumptions get embedded into the AI systems now shaping all of us, and whether the humans behind those systems are thinking clearly enough to matter.
Born in Puerto Rico and shaped by leadership experience across the United States and Latin America, Quiles has spent more than 15 years inside the rooms where digital transformation either happens or stalls. He has seen firsthand both what rigorous thinking makes possible and what inherited, unexamined assumptions destroy in organizations, institutions, and entire economies.
His book, Dismantled: A Theory of Broken Mindsets: A Blueprint of Infinite Futures, distills that experience into a framework leaders can actually use. Drawing on the collapse of Kodak, Blockbuster, and Nokia alongside stories of resilience from Puerto Rico, Haiti, and Medellín, Dismantled introduces the Dismantled Mindset framework and the Perspective Shift Canvas, structured tools for surfacing the inherited assumptions that quietly limit organizations and replacing them with thinking designed for what comes next.
“Dismantled is not a book about AI. It is a book about the human mind in an age when AI makes clear thinking both more urgent and more rare.”
FC Quiles is the founder of four operating AI ventures: Emerging Rule, an AI-powered K–12 personalized learning platform; RaceFor.AI, a collaborative AI strategy network across the Americas; Glápagos, a regional AI DevOps platform; and HUBVERY, focused on intercontinental autonomous delivery. He also serves as founder of GENIA America, advancing AI adoption across the Western Hemisphere. He has advised enterprises, governments, and startups on building funded AI roadmaps and remained through full implementation, not just strategy delivery.
